Tetra Nightlight is cord-free

With absolutely no cords attached to this light you can put it anywhere you like. You won’t be restricted by the location of outlets within your home. Just find a dark corner that you’d like to brighten and leave it there. It’s actually made for a child’s room, but it won’t discriminate between adults and children. It’d be happy to offer light to all ages.
This looks like an odd little milk carton, so it’d be even more cute if your child has a toy kitchen of some kind. To turn it on you just press the button that’s directly on the bottom. You won’t have to worry about it hurting anyone, because it doesn’t have a single hot spot on the light. In order to keep it powered you just need 3 AAA batteries. The Tetra Nightlight will cost you $42 through Etsy.
